Course Details
• Introduction to Security Management in Humanitarian Crises: Understanding the security context, key actors, and principles of security risk management in humanitarian crises.
• Threat and Risk Assessment: Identifying and analyzing potential threats, vulnerabilities, and risks to humanitarian personnel, assets, and operations.
• Security Planning and Strategy: Developing and implementing comprehensive security plans and strategies, including context analysis, risk mitigation measures, and contingency planning.
• Operational Security Management: Managing security operations, including incident management, crisis response, and business continuity planning.
• Staff Safety and Well-being: Ensuring the safety and well-being of humanitarian staff, including travel security, medical preparedness, and psychosocial support.
• Protection of Beneficiaries: Ensuring the safety and protection of beneficiaries, including gender-based violence prevention and response, child protection, and safeguarding.
• Security Technology and Innovation: Utilizing security technology and innovative solutions to enhance security risk management, including surveillance, access control, and communication systems.
• Partnership and Coordination: Building partnerships and coordinating with local authorities, security forces, and other humanitarian actors to enhance security and access.
• Monitoring, Evaluation, and Learning: Monitoring and evaluating security management practices, identifying lessons learned, and implementing improvements.
